Hello everyone,

I wanted to bring to your attention an important update regarding the Trakt API. Starting March 4, 2025, the expiration period for access tokens will be reduced from 3 months to just 24 hours.

I don't know if this change will directly impact the Trakt plugin for Emby, because maybe the expiration handling already takes the "expires_in" field into account. But if it doesn't, token handling will need to be adjusted to accommodate the shorter expiration period. I received this information via an email from Trakt.

Here's the discussion link in case you are interested: https://github.com/trakt/api-help/discussions/495

Trakt suggests setting the refresh token to 24 hours, following what they sent via email: 'Important API access_token updates':

Starting on March 20, 2025, an OAuth access_token will expire in 24 hours, instead of 3 months. Since you've created a Trakt API app, we wanted to let you know directly.

Yeah thanks @jayfizzefor the report. I haven't been able to test it myself today, but I will report with my findings later today.
 

If the refresh time is hardcoded on the emby plugin, it will need fixing. I looked for the code on github but I believe it's not being publically released anymore. But in the code that's currently available, there's a 2 month refresh period hardcoded:

https://github.com/MediaBrowser/trakt/blob/0431fbf4f4f66347ee16a959277111efb6594b44/Trakt/Api/TraktApi.cs#L1051
